Trophic Cascades: Predators, Prey and the Dynamics of Nature

Eminent biologist Professor John W. Terborgh has to his credit a lifetime of major contributions to tropical ecology, biogeography and biological conservation.

The Director of the Center for Tropical Conservation at Duke University, he discusses trophic cascades, which is the top-down regulation of ecosystems by predators, and to explain what they are, how they work and why they matter.
